More and more I see of Wellington, more I fell in love with it. Today, we went deep in the heart of the city to explore its main attractions which is Civic Square and Parliament House. Wellington is a mini version of London, they share similar attractions such as Civic Square which is likened to Trafalgar Square and Parliament House though the Wellington version is much more modernised.
We then went to a souvenir warehouse to cash in the rare opportunity to buy some gifts for our families. It was when we all assembled on the campervan and set up our sat-nav, to our horror, it was a 4 hours' drive not 2 hours that we have previously thought.
During the journey, the condition of the campervan deteriorated even further, we had to use one of the table legs as a wedge to stop a drawer spilling out because the lock doesn't work anymore!
We eventually arrived in Napier and were advised by a gentleman working in YHA to camp in a car park overnight which normally was illegal but we don't find any signs advising against this so we parked there overnight. We watched a DVD and drank wine that we bought in Brisbane.
